diff --git a/src/calibre/gui2/palette.py b/src/calibre/gui2/palette.py index 3657a3abeb..5989013368 100644 --- a/src/calibre/gui2/palette.py +++ b/src/calibre/gui2/palette.py @@ -15,16 +15,17 @@ def dark_palette(): p = QPalette() dark_color = QColor(45,45,45) disabled_color = QColor(127,127,127) + text_color = QColor('#eee') p.setColor(p.Window, dark_color) - p.setColor(p.WindowText, QColor('#eee')) + p.setColor(p.WindowText, text_color) p.setColor(p.Base, QColor(18,18,18)) p.setColor(p.AlternateBase, dark_color) p.setColor(p.ToolTipBase, dark_color) - p.setColor(p.ToolTipText, Qt.white) - p.setColor(p.Text, Qt.white) + p.setColor(p.ToolTipText, text_color) + p.setColor(p.Text, text_color) p.setColor(p.Disabled, p.Text, disabled_color) p.setColor(p.Button, dark_color) - p.setColor(p.ButtonText, Qt.white) + p.setColor(p.ButtonText, text_color) p.setColor(p.Disabled, p.ButtonText, disabled_color) p.setColor(p.BrightText, Qt.red) p.setColor(p.Link, dark_link_color) @@ -32,4 +33,5 @@ def dark_palette(): p.setColor(p.Highlight, dark_link_color) p.setColor(p.HighlightedText, Qt.black) p.setColor(p.Disabled, p.HighlightedText, disabled_color) + return p